Common Name4Alpha-methyl-5alpha-cholesta-8-en-3-one
Description4Alpha-methyl-5alpha-cholesta-8-en-3-one belongs to the class of organic compounds known as cholesterols and derivatives. Cholesterols and derivatives are compounds containing a 3-hydroxylated cholestane core.
